Moving Water: Maximizing Flow at Dump & Fill Sites

This episode of Moving Water covers the nuts and bolts of optimizing fill and dump site efficiency. One takeaway: don’t wait for ideal conditions or perfect resources to get started. Begin with small, workable components—perhaps a single dump tank paired with one pumper—and add backup and redundancy progressively. This approach keeps your operation agile, prevents overwhelming personnel and apparatus, and ensures steady water flow early in the incident. Second: know the capabilities of your equipment and your mutual aid resources before the call. A hydrant delivering 250 gallons per minute is a vastly different asset than one flowing 1,000 GPM, and mismatched apparatus at fill sites can throttle flow and delay suppression efforts. Third, deploying two suction lines to draft simultaneously can dramatically increase flow rates while reducing pump RPM and extending apparatus life. From methodical system building to practical hardware choices and staffing strategies, this episode offers actionable knowledge extending beyond theory into real-world application.
